The reddish appearance of the sun at sunrise and sunset is due to

Options

(a) the colour of the sky
(b) the scattering of light
(c) the polarisation of light
(d) the colour of the sun

Correct Answer:

the scattering of light

Explanation:

It is due to scattering of light. Scattering ∞ 1/λ⁴. Hence the light reaches us is rich in red.
